Hi everyone. This is a real surprise! I just received this fabulous new Harrods solid for 2008! This is a beautiful solid of an English Riding Saddle with boots and cap. It's called English Rider. Approx. 2″ tall. The enamel work is great and I love the “H” insignia for Harrods that is on the saddle blanket. Retails for 200 BP which for us in the US is high due to exchange rate. HI everyone. Found out some interesting info on the English Rider. Supposedly, there are only 40 pieces in the first lot received by Harrods and they are almost sold out. There is no info on any additional ones to be received, so maybe…this will really be a “limited edition”!!!. Wouldn't that be great!
